Fall's Sun Isn't Done With Us Yet—Neither Is the Eyewear

The calendar says autumn, but in Palm Beach the glare hasn't gotten the memo, and the season's sunglasses lineup is built for exactly that kind of stubborn light. Cat-eyes bring the shape back into the conversation, oversized frames do the coverage work a lower fall sun demands, and aviators hold their ground as the style that never really left. Between the three, there's a pair for every face and every kind of squint-inducing afternoon on the water or the avenue. Consider it the season's most practical accessory upgrade, style included.
